I recently tried LUSH Each Peach Massage Bar recently and I liked it quite a bit. I was looking forward to a peachy smelling bar that melted on my skin and left it soft and fragrant. Well, this bar melts easily and leaves my skin soft but I smell not even a hint of peach and only lemon - which isn't even IN the ingredients!
The Bar
The bar is 2.2 ounces and oval. It is cream colored, lighter than butter, with a peach tree branch design on one side. One whiff overwhelmed me with straight up, fresh squeezed lemon juice and nothing else. I loved it!
My Use
The scent isn't fake or like furniture polish. It smells just like I sliced open a lemon and squeezed it all over me. It looks like a bar of soap but is to be used on dry skin. I used the flat side and swiped it across my arms and, immediately, my arms were greasy. I was a little shocked at how oily this bar was but, after all, it is a massage bar and massages generally use oil. I had no problem spreading the oils on my skin and they absorbed quickly. The scent remained very strong, almost too strong for my liking and I love strong lemon scents.
As for massage use, I could see how this would work well. However, my husband hates greasy stuff and hasn't given me a massage in a million years. (We've been married for over 20 years; it's a miracle we still speak.)
The oils absorb fast on my dry skin. And the scent! It lasts forever. I felt like a huge walking lemon for hours. I even woke up smelling lemony after using the bar the afternoon before.
This bar is pricey at $7.95 for a mere 2.2 ounces and it seems to want to melt into a puddle if it gets too warm. I keep it in a tin away from heat because there is nothing to prevent it from melting. The only ingredient that isn't natural in this bar is the fragrance.
Not a trace of lemon in the bar yet I couldn't tell which was the real lemon and which was the Each Peach Massage Bar if I did a blind sniff test. Go figure.
My Viewpoint
This is a somewhat strange little bar of oils and butters. It is a good moisturizer, although not as rich and thick as body butter. It melts on contact and leaves a greasy veil on my skin but a quick rub down and the oils absorb into my skin and leave it soft and very fragrant. It is a quick fix for dry skin and would make for a fragrant, heady massage. Maybe I will ask the old hubby to give me a massage for research purchases. That, in itself, would be worth the cost of this bar! 4 stars!
